The CPU Module occupies the top portion of the Cube and provides the CPU, Ethernet Network Interface Controller (NIC), indicator lights, timing/trigger interface, configuration ports and internal power supply. It’s the brains of the Cube and controls the unit’s operations, including the interface with the host Controller (and other Cubes), as well as supervising the activity of the I/O boards. The CPU module also includes rotary switches that set the Cube’s EtherCAT device address. If the switch is set to address 0, the unit’s address is programmed by any EtherCAT master. In addition to connecting to other Cubes, the DNA-ECAT series can be installed in any chain with ETG conforming devices.

The remainder of the Cube is dedicated to I/O slots or layers. These slots are populated with the I/O modules that are selected to match your process or test application. We currently offer: A/D boards to measure voltage, current, strain gages, thermocouples, D/A boards with outputs to ±40V or ±50 mA, Digital I/O interfaces for logic and “real-world” signal levels, counters and timers, quadrature encoder inputs, RVDT/LVDT, and simulated signals such as RTDs, TCs, etc.

You can choose from 2, 4, and 8 slot styles. The DNA-ECAT series cubes feature:

  • > 2 kHz scan rates
  • Configuration via EtherCAT Master - Modules and Slots
  • No external program or connection needed
  • Wide input power range: 9 to 36 VDC
  • Up to 200/256 analog input/output and 384 digital I/O channels per Cube
  • Extended temperature range: -40 C to 85° C
  • Rugged: 5g vibration, 100g shock
